Please be aware there is no direct customer service team number. The methods of support for fastest and most efficient service still remain the support button up top which takes you to a form, and the email of support@woot.com (that is where the form mails).
Additionally, when you email, do remember a few things:
1 - you should always get an auto reply with a case number, if you don't get one of these, you didn't get through
2 - if you did get through please be aware it can take 1-2 business days to get a reply, but note you're in a queue and we appreciate your patience
3 - check your spam folder diligently, because spam folders have huge WOOT magnets that attract our mail on occasion
4 - try to keep your case all in one place, which is to say constantly reply to one ticket, and if you file another ticket, always mention any other case numbers so you can keep your data together (it will also help them close all the cases created when your issue is solved, thus speeding up the queue for everyone else)
Again, please be aware there is no customer service phone number at woot. Thank you for understanding.
